If the 12's are center tapped, the extra resistance in the cables to the six volts may tend to prevent them from becoming fully charged. The same thing happens when drawing from them. So the 12 volts will charge first--and that will taper the charge rate to the sixes.
If on the outer ends (method #2) then the 12 volt batteries will be the ones not getting fully charged--and not providing as much current.
I would balance the wiring myself. But that will cost you for cables. And the 12's were free.
